Introduction
Integrity is one of the most vital qualities a person can possess, both in professional and personal life. It means doing the right thing even when no one is watching — being honest, trustworthy, and consistent in words and actions. In Islam and in universal ethics, integrity is considered a cornerstone of character that defines a person’s true worth.
The Meaning of Working with Integrity
Working with integrity means maintaining honesty, transparency, and fairness in all your dealings. It is about fulfilling your duties sincerely, avoiding deceit, and ensuring that your actions align with moral and ethical principles. Whether you are an employee, employer, or entrepreneur, integrity shapes your reputation and earns you respect from others.
Integrity in Islam and Daily Work
Islam places great emphasis on honesty and integrity in all aspects of life. The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) said:
“The truthful and trustworthy businessman will be with the Prophets, the truthful, and the martyrs.” (Tirmidhi)
This hadith highlights that integrity in work is not merely a professional virtue but a spiritual duty. A Muslim should never cheat, lie, or deceive in trade or employment. Every task, no matter how small, is an opportunity to demonstrate sincerity and righteousness.
Benefits of Working with Integrity
- Builds Trust: People respect and rely on those who act with honesty and fairness.
- Strengthens Reputation: A person known for integrity becomes a role model and a source of guidance.
- Ensures Inner Peace: Living truthfully brings mental satisfaction and removes guilt or fear.
- Promotes Long-Term Success: While dishonesty might bring short-term gains, integrity leads to sustainable achievements.
- Earns Divine Blessings (Barakah): When you work sincerely for Allah’s sake, your efforts are blessed with barakah and fulfillment.
How to Develop Integrity at Work
- Be Honest in All Dealings: Never misrepresent facts or take undue credit.
- Honor Commitments: Fulfill promises and meet deadlines responsibly.
- Avoid Corruption or Deception: Stay away from unethical shortcuts.
- Lead by Example: Inspire others by maintaining fairness and respect in the workplace.
- Remember Accountability: Always act with the awareness that Allah is watching.
